A sportsbook is a place where people can make bets on various sporting events. These bets can be placed either online or at a physical location. In order to be successful, a sportsbook must have a good understanding of the industry and the market it serves. It also needs to be able to calculate and balance the risk of each bet that is placed on the site. A sportsbook should be able to offer competitive odds for all major leagues and competitions. The odds for each event are calculated by taking into account the number of bettors and the amount they are willing to stake. The sportsbook will then adjust the odds to try to balance the action on both sides of a bet. Some sportsbooks will also offer your money back when a push occurs against the spread.
Creating a sportsbook is not an easy task and it requires a significant investment of time and money. This is because it is not only about the software and payment methods, but also about integrating with data providers, odds providers, KYC verification suppliers, risk management systems and more. However, if you are well-funded and have the resources to dedicate to your project, it can be a great way to start a profitable business.
There are many different software solutions that can be used to create a sportsbook, but not all of them are equal. Some are more flexible than others, and some are less expensive than others. In addition, some provide features that are not available in other software. These features may include a live streaming feature, a mobile app, and a widget for betting on the go.
A user-friendly UI is essential to the success of any sportsbook. It should have clear, easily navigable links for each sport and market. It should also include a search box to help users quickly find what they are looking for. This will improve the overall user experience and keep players engaged.
One of the most common mistakes that sportsbooks make is not focusing on their users. If your product is not user-friendly, your users will get frustrated and look for other options. A poorly designed sportsbook can even lead to a loss of revenue. To avoid this, it is important to have a team of experienced UX and design experts on board.
Another mistake that many sportsbooks make is not having enough betting markets. Customers are increasingly demanding more choice when it comes to the sports and events they can bet on. For example, they want to see many betting markets for football fixtures, including match and ante-post ones, as well as handicaps, totals and more speculative bets like first or last scorer.
While white labeling offers some flexibility, it can limit your ability to innovate. If you develop something new, you may have to wait for the provider to roll it out to their other customers. This can be a problem if you want to launch a cutting-edge sportsbook that will take some time to have an impact on the market.